Hey — quick handover on the loyalty ledger (Pointstack). Nightly reconciliation runs at 02:00; if it flags drift, don't manually adjust balances, just rerun with `--dry-run` first and file a ticket. Pager alerts are tuned, so real pages are real. If anything looks weird overnight, ping the person named below.

named custodian: Brivan Eliath Quenox Frador

Step 4: Migrating the reminder job. The Bramblewood Clinic appointment reminder job moves from the legacy cron host to the Quillhaven scheduler. Before enabling it, verify the timezone handling: reminders must fire in the patient's local zone, not server time, or early-morning messages will go out at night. Disable the legacy job only after one full overlap cycle has completed cleanly. Then provision the new worker with the configuration values below.

service settings:
novath:
  pin: 1396
  tenant: pelys
  seal: seal_ccc035e1
  metrics_host: metrics.novath.qorvelworks.test
  standby_team: fraeth
  escalation: drueth-zorok
  nonce: 61d508

Every UI component is rendered in a sandboxed headless browser, and the resulting snapshots are compared byte-for-byte against the committed baselines. For security review purposes, note that the sandbox has no network egress, baselines are content-addressed, and any mismatch blocks promotion to staging until a reviewer approves the diff. Baseline updates require a signed commit from a maintainer. The deployment stage consumes the configuration values listed below.

deployment values, bagag-bawig:
DRUVAN_PIN=0740
DRUVAN_TENANT=wendor
DRUVAN_METRICS_HOST=metrics.druvan.tolvaqnet.example
DRUVAN_SEAL=seal_75cd0b2d
DRUVAN_STANDBY_TEAM=tamael